Essential Ingredients & Substitutions

Core Ingredients

  • Beef: Flank steak, sirloin, or ground beef
  • Bell Peppers: Red, yellow, or green for color and crunch
  • Rice: Jasmine, basmati, or brown rice
  • Onion: For sweetness and depth
  • Garlic & Ginger: Aromatic base
  • Soy Sauce: Umami and saltiness
  • Oyster Sauce or Hoisin Sauce: For richness
  • Sesame Oil: Nutty finish

Optional Add-Ins

  • Broccoli, snap peas, or carrots for extra veggies
  • Chili flakes or sriracha for heat
  • Toasted sesame seeds for garnish

Substitutions

  • Protein: Use chicken, tofu, or shrimp for variety
  • Grain: Try quinoa or cauliflower rice for a low-carb option
  • Gluten-Free: Use tamari instead of soy sauce

Step-by-Step Recipe Instructions

1. Prep Your Ingredients

  • Slice beef thinly against the grain for tenderness.
  • Cut bell peppers and onions into strips.
  • Mince garlic and ginger.

2. Cook the Rice

  • Rinse rice until water runs clear.
  • Cook according to package instructions; keep warm.

3. Sear the Beef

  • Heat oil in a large skillet or wok over high heat.
  • Add beef in a single layer; sear until browned (about 2-3 minutes).
  • Remove beef and set aside.

4. Sauté the Vegetables

  • In the same pan, add a bit more oil if needed.
  • Sauté onions, garlic, and ginger until fragrant.
  • Add bell peppers; cook until just tender.

5. Combine & Sauce

  • Return beef to the pan.
  • Add soy sauce, oyster sauce, and a splash of water.
  • Toss everything together until well coated and heated through.

6. Assemble the Bowl

  • Spoon rice into bowls.
  • Top with beef and pepper mixture.
  • Drizzle with sesame oil and sprinkle with sesame seeds.

Pro Tip: For extra flavor, marinate the beef in soy sauce, garlic, and a pinch of sugar for 15 minutes before cooking.


Tips for the Perfect Beef & Pepper Rice Bowl

  • Slice Beef Thinly: Ensures quick, even cooking and tenderness.
  • High Heat: Sear beef and veggies quickly to retain texture and color.
  • Don’t Overcrowd the Pan: Cook in batches if needed for best browning.
  • Balance the Sauce: Taste and adjust soy, oyster, and sweetness to your liking.
  • Rest the Beef: Let cooked beef rest briefly before slicing for juicier results.

Meal Prep & Make-Ahead Strategies

  • Batch Cooking: Double the recipe and store in meal prep containers.
  • Separate Components: Keep rice and beef mixture separate for best texture.
  • Reheating: Microwave with a splash of water to keep rice moist.
  • Freezer Friendly: Freeze cooked beef and peppers; thaw and reheat as needed.

FAQs: Beef & Pepper Rice Bowl

Q: Can I use leftover steak or roast beef?
A: Absolutely! Slice thin and add at the end to warm through.

Q: How do I make this vegetarian?
A: Use tofu or tempeh and a plant-based sauce.

Q: Can I freeze this dish?
A: Yes, freeze the beef and pepper mixture separately from the rice for best results.

Q: What’s the best rice to use?
A: Jasmine or basmati for fragrance, or brown rice for extra fiber.

Q: How do I keep the beef tender?
A: Slice against the grain and avoid overcooking.

Printable Recipe Card

Beef & Pepper Rice Bowl

  • 1 lb beef (flank or sirloin), thinly sliced
  • 2 bell peppers, sliced
  • 1 onion, s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p ginger, minced
  • 2 cups cooked rice
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p oyster sauce
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• 1 tbsp vegetable oil

Instructions:

  1. Cook rice and keep warm.
  2. Sear beef in hot oil; set aside.
  3. Sauté onion, garlic, ginger, and peppers.
  4. Return beef, add sauces, toss to coat.
  5. Serve over rice, garnish as desired.
